Over the course of 2009 InsideView received highly regarded accolades from the sales community, including :

  • JMP Securities Hot 100 List of best privately held software companies
  • High praises from the research firm Aberdeen Group in their independent study
  • Being ranked as the highest-rated application at the salesforce.com AppExchange
  • Being named alongside Google and Facebook by CRM Magazine as a “Rising Star” in companies pushing the boundaries of social CRM

In the latter half of 2009 we partnered with NetSuite and released an application to leverage social networking, including Facebook and Twitter, within both Customer Relationship Management and Enterprise Resource Planning.

In May, InsideView also launched the Smart Cloud and Buzz Tab to incorporate real-time social media monitoring into all major CRM applications, while significantly enhancing our technology’s integrations with both Oracle CRM On Demand and Siebel CRM applications in support of Oracle’s Social CRM initiative.
